apt Linux ขนาดเล็ก


9

ฉันต้องการเซ็ตอัพ VMs บางตัวที่ใช้ Linux ให้เล็กที่สุดเท่าที่จะทำได้

เกณฑ์:

  1. ระบบแพคเกจขึ้นอยู่กับ Apt

  2. ใช้งาน GUI บางตัว (อาจเล็กมาก)

  3. ทำงานในหน่วยความจำน้อยที่สุดเท่าที่เป็นไปได้: ในบริบทนี้ 64M นั้นดีและ 256M นั้นล้อมรอบมากเกินไป

  4. ติดตั้งบน hd ไม่ใช่ ram ram

  5. เป็นพื้นที่ HD เล็กน้อยที่สุด อุดมคติจะเป็น 1G

  6. บูตเร็วและปิดเครื่องครั้ง

ข้อเสนอแนะ?


2
ฉันขอถามได้ไหมว่าทำไมมันต้องเป็นไปตามความถนัด
Keith

1
ฉันยังตั้งคำถามถึงความต้องการ apt เพราะมันค่อนข้างใช้หน่วยความจำมาก หากคุณได้รับระบบที่ทำงานใน 64MB คุณอาจต้องเพิ่มมันในขณะที่คุณกำลังใช้งาน
Gilles 'ดังนั้นหยุดความชั่วร้าย'

1
Tshepang เพิ่งเตือนฉันถึงการมีอยู่ของ dselectซึ่งถ้าคุณอยู่ใน Debian (หรือระบบอื่นที่ใช้ dpkg) นั้นเป็นความถนัดที่น้อยกว่า แต่ใช้หน่วยความจำน้อยลง
Gilles 'หยุดความชั่วร้าย'

คำตอบ:


7

Debian

ตามที่พวกเขา RAM ขนาด 64 mb ก็เพียงพอที่จะรันด้วย GUI และพวกมันคือการกระจายตัวของ Apt แบบดั้งเดิม คุณควรจำไว้ว่าแนะนำให้ใช้ 256 mb แม้ว่าจะไม่มี GUI ก็ตาม

พวกเขาทำรายการ HD 5 GB สำหรับ "เดสก์ท็อป" แต่คุณควรจะสามารถติดตั้งตัวจัดการหน้าต่าง / เว็บเบราว์เซอร์ / อื่น ๆ ได้ภายในขีด จำกัด 1 GB หากคุณเริ่มจากการติดตั้งขั้นต่ำ 2 GB ต่อดิสก์เสมือนอาจเป็นวิธีที่ดีที่สุดหรือคุณเสี่ยงที่จะมีหน่วยความจำในการสลับหน่วยความจำหมด

หากคุณคุ้นเคยกับ apt (itude) เพียงพอไม่ควรเพิ่มเฉพาะซอฟต์แวร์ที่คุณต้องการ distro มินิมัลลิสต์ใด ๆ จะมีอคติกับเป้าหมายของผู้เขียนและหยุดรับการอัปเดตเมื่อคุณต้องการ


ไม่ใช่ว่าฉันแนะนำ GNU / Linux จริง ๆ การกำหนดค่าระบบมินิมอลจากข้างบนบรรทัดคำสั่งนั้นเป็นเรื่องที่ยุ่งเหยิงที่ฉันไม่เคยทำมาก่อนซึ่งทำให้ฉันขาดความถนัดและแหล่งเก็บข้อมูล Debian ที่ไม่มีที่สิ้นสุดและย้ายไปที่ OpenBSD ซึ่งเพิ่งใช้งานได้

1
repositories-- @jbcreix ฉันแนะนำ distro's ที่ไม่รู้จักแนวคิดของ repository จริงหรือมีชุดเดียวและมันไม่ได้เหยียบนิ้วเท้า repo อื่น ๆ ทั้ง gentooและarch linuxได้รับการออกแบบมาโดยไม่จำเป็นต้องมี repos ภายนอก ในส่วนโค้งคุณอาจต้องเปิดใช้งาน repos ที่ไม่ใช่แกนหลัก แต่ฉันคิดว่าพวกเขากำลังอยู่ในช่วงเริ่มต้น
xenoterracide

@xenoterracide: ครวญเพลง Debian เป็นอย่างนั้น ฉันหมายถึงพวกเขามีหนึ่ง repo ต่อหนึ่งเวอร์ชัน แต่การผสมให้เข้ากันนั้นเป็นสิ่งที่ท้อแท้อย่างยิ่ง
AndréParamés

@ และแน่ใจว่าได้รับฟังก์ชั่นเดสก์ทอปเต็มรูปแบบที่คุณต้องเพิ่ม repo ของเดเบียน แต่ฉันอาจจะผิด แน่นอนว่ามันมีหนึ่งชุดหลัก แต่ฉันจำได้ว่าเพิ่ม repo ในอูบุนตูเพื่อรับทุกสิ่งที่ฉันต้องการฉันรู้ว่า debian ไม่ใช่อูบุนตู
xenoterracide

1
@xenoterracide: ไม่, repo หลักของ Debian มีทุกอย่าง; KDE, Gnome, XFCE, ฯลฯ : packages.debian.org/stable
AndréParamés

3

Damn Small Linuxจะทำให้ Debian ดูใหญ่โต หาก HD มีขนาดเพียง 50MB คุณสามารถเชื่อว่ารอยเท้าหน่วยความจำมีขนาดเล็กเช่นกัน มันใช้ knoppix ซึ่งมีพื้นฐานจาก debian ดังนั้น AFAIK จึงใช้apt

Damn Small Linux คือการกระจาย Linux แบบเดสก์ท็อปขนาดเล็กที่ใช้งานได้หลากหลายมาก
เดิมที DSL ได้รับการพัฒนาเป็นการทดลองเพื่อดูว่ามีแอปพลิเคชันเดสก์ท็อปที่สามารถใช้งานได้กี่ตัวใน CD สด 50MB ในตอนแรกมันเป็นแค่เครื่องมือ / ของเล่นส่วนตัว แต่เมื่อเวลาผ่านไป Damn Small Linux ได้เติบโตเป็นโครงการชุมชนที่มีการพัฒนาหลายร้อยชั่วโมงซึ่งรวมถึงระบบการติดตั้งแอพพลิเคชั่นในระยะไกลและระบบอัตโนมัติและการสำรองและกู้คืนระบบที่หลากหลายซึ่งสามารถใช้กับสื่อที่เขียนได้ ฟลอปปี้ไดรฟ์หรืออุปกรณ์ USB

หมายเหตุสำคัญ: เห็นได้ชัดว่า Damn Small Linux ไม่ได้รับการดูแลรักษาอีกต่อไป


Tiny Core Linuxถือได้ว่าเป็นความต่อเนื่องของ DSL ไม่ได้มีพื้นฐานมาจาก Apt ซึ่งเป็นข้อกำหนดที่แปลกอยู่แล้ว
jonescb

@ โจนส์, mebbe ฉันผิด แต่ฉันคิดว่าคุณสามารถใช้ apt ใน dsl ได้ เห็นได้ชัดว่ามีมาหลายปีแล้วตั้งแต่ฉันใช้มัน
xenoterracide

2

ผมไม่ทราบของลินุกซ์ apt-ตามที่เป็นจริงขนาดเล็ก แต่ถ้าคุณเอาว่าหนึ่งในความต้องการ (apt-based) จะสามารถแนะนำSlitaz

ไฟล์ ISO คือ 30MB มันมาพร้อมกับ GUI และเว็บเบราว์เซอร์ที่ใช้งานได้ มันยังคงได้รับการดูแลเมื่อเทียบกับ DSL ซึ่งดูเหมือนว่าจะถูกทอดทิ้งมาระยะหนึ่งแล้ว

Slitaz ใช้tazpkgสำหรับการจัดการซึ่งจากความเห็นของฉันเป็นเรื่องง่ายเหมือนฉลาด:

tazpkg list
tazpkg get-install gparted
tazpkg upgrade

DSL ถูกเลิกใช้เมื่อใด
xenoterracide

2
@xenoterracide: ขออภัยที่ใช้ภาษาผิดไป ฉันพยายามที่จะหมายถึง "ละทิ้ง" ตามหน้าวิกิพีเดียมันบอกว่ารุ่นเสถียรล่าสุดได้ดีกว่า 2 ปีที่ผ่านมา IIRC มีเหตุผลว่าทำไมตัวเริ่มต้น
แพ็

1

Crunchbang Linux

มันเคยเป็นไปตาม Ubuntu แต่ตอนนี้มันขึ้นอยู่กับ Debian มันมาพร้อมกับ Openbox ในฐานะผู้จัดการหน้าต่างเริ่มต้น การติดตั้ง Debian เริ่มต้นใช้ Gnome ซึ่งค่อนข้างจะเล็กกว่า Openbox

แก้ไข: Crunchbang ถูกยกเลิกแล้ว มีชุมชนที่ต่อเนื่องของโครงการที่เรียกว่า BunsenLabs Linux ลิงค์ Crunchbang ด้านบนจะนำคุณไปสู่ลิงค์ดังกล่าว


0

เดเบียนอาจมีขนาดค่อนข้างเล็ก ระหว่างการติดตั้งเมื่อคุณไปที่ taskel ให้ยกเลิกการเลือกทุกอย่าง คุณจะได้รับระบบน้อยมากโดยใช้เพียง 512M แม้ว่าคุณจะยังสามารถลบแพ็คเกจที่คุณไม่ได้ใช้



โ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.